Transaction a592975157e80ecbcb605ee4abf7f9146ce8f05a88d4e4f36a3da5d692b343c4
1 Input
1 Output
-
a592975157e80ecbcb605ee4abf7f9146ce8f05a88d4e4f36a3da5d692b343c4:0
- value
- 6354624
- script pubkey
- OP_0 OP_PUSHBYTES_20 de44fb608a87692878fa57753acd2a28be5d9f5a
- address
- bc1qmez0kcy2sa5js7862a6n4nf29zl9m8664xpxnq